Main Program (PoC.py)¶
The main program PoC.py expects the environment variable
PoCRootDirectory to be set.
PoC.py¶
This is the PoC-Library Service Tool.
usage: PoC.py [--prj ProjectID] [--sln SolutionID] [-q] [-v] [-d] [--dryrun]
[-D]
{list-project,quartus,coregen,configure,help,asim,info,vsim,vivado,ghdl,ise,list-testbench,isim,cocotb,lse,query,xst,xci,list-solution,xsim,remove-solution,add-solution,rpro,list-netlist}
...
-
--prj<projectid>¶ Project name.
-
--sln<solutionid>¶ Solution name.
-
-q,--quiet¶ Reduce messages to a minimum.
-
-v,--verbose¶ Print out detailed messages.
-
-d,--debug¶ Enable debug mode.
-
--dryrun¶ Don’t execute external programs.
-
-D¶ Enable script wrapper debug mode. See also
poc.ps1 -D.

PoC.py asim¶
Simulate a PoC Entity with Aldec Active-HDL.
usage: PoC.py asim [-h] [-g] [-a] [-e] [-R] [-s] [-w] [-C] [-W] [-S] [-r]
[--std VHDLVersion] [--device DeviceName]
[--board BoardName]
PoC Entity [PoC Entity ...]
-
pocentity¶ A space separated list of PoC entities.
-
-h,--help¶ show this help message and exit
-
-g,--gui¶ Run all steps (prepare, analysis, elaboration, optimization, simulation) and finally display the waveform in a GUI window.
-
-a,--analyze¶ Run only the prepare and analysis step.
-
-e,--elaborate¶ Run only the prepare and elaboration step.
-
-R,--recompile¶ Run all compile steps (prepare, analysis, elaboration, optimization).
-
-s,--simulate¶ Run only the prepare and simulation step.
-
-w,--showwave¶ Run only the prepare step and display the waveform in a GUI window.
-
-C,--showcoverage¶ Run only the prepare step and display the coverage data in a GUI window.
-
-W,--review¶ Run only display the waveform in a GUI window.
-
-S,--resimulate¶ Run all simulation steps (prepare, simulation) and finally display the waveform in a GUI window.
-
-r,--showreport¶ Show a simulation report.
-
--std<vhdlversion>¶ Simulate with VHDL-??
-
--device<devicename>¶ The target platform’s device name.
-
--board<boardname>¶ The target platform’s board name.

PoC.py ghdl¶
Simulate a PoC Entity with GHDL.
usage: PoC.py ghdl [-h] [--reproducer Name] [--with-coverage] [-g] [-a] [-e]
[-R] [-s] [-w] [-C] [-W] [-S] [-r] [--std VHDLVersion]
[--device DeviceName] [--board BoardName]
PoC Entity [PoC Entity ...]
-
pocentity¶ A space separated list of PoC entities.
-
-h,--help¶ show this help message and exit
-
--reproducer<name>¶ Create a bug reproducer
-
--with-coverage¶ Compile with coverage information.
-
-g,--gui¶ Run all steps (prepare, analysis, elaboration, optimization, simulation) and finally display the waveform in a GUI window.
-
-a,--analyze¶ Run only the prepare and analysis step.
-
-e,--elaborate¶ Run only the prepare and elaboration step.
-
-R,--recompile¶ Run all compile steps (prepare, analysis, elaboration, optimization).
-
-s,--simulate¶ Run only the prepare and simulation step.
-
-w,--showwave¶ Run only the prepare step and display the waveform in a GUI window.
-
-C,--showcoverage¶ Run only the prepare step and display the coverage data in a GUI window.
-
-W,--review¶ Run only display the waveform in a GUI window.
-
-S,--resimulate¶ Run all simulation steps (prepare, simulation) and finally display the waveform in a GUI window.
-
-r,--showreport¶ Show a simulation report.
-
--std<vhdlversion>¶ Simulate with VHDL-??
-
--device<devicename>¶ The target platform’s device name.
-
--board<boardname>¶ The target platform’s board name.
